Visual Studio Code 휴지통에서 삭제 된 파일 복원


111

Visual Studio Code 버전 1.8.1을 사용하여 휴지통에서 삭제 된 파일을 복원하려면 어떻게해야합니까?


5
VS Code는 프로그램 내부에서 그 힌트를 보여주기 때문에이 질문이 매우 합법적이라고 생각합니다. 나도 인터넷 검색 (그리고 여기에 착륙)하기 전과 시스템 쓰레기통을보기 전에 프로그램 내부를 잠시 찾았습니다.)
Manuel Manhart

예, 이것은 부족한 기능입니다
ACV

답변:


174

시스템의 일반 쓰레기통을 사용합니다. 그래서 당신은 그것을 거기에서 잡을 수 있습니다.

Windows에서는 탐색기에서 찾을 수 있고 Linux에서는 Konquerer / Nemo / ...에서도 찾을 수 있습니다.


1
Linux에서는 trash-cli패키지 와 함께 터미널을 사용하여 복원 할 수 있습니다 . trash-list휴지통에있는 모든 파일을 나열하므로 trash-restore foofoo라는 파일을 복원하는 과정을 안내합니다. Linux 휴지통에 액세스 할 수있는 GUI 앱이 설치되지 않은 ChromeOS에서 유용합니다.
Ray Foss

1
실수로 중요한 파일을 RM으로 만들고 trash-cli가 트릭을 수행했기 때문에 여기에 도착했습니다. 당신은 litteraly 나 @Ray 저장
SamuelRousseaux

대단히 감사합니다 !!!
Vương Hữu Thiện

24
  1. 먼저 로컬 컴퓨터의 휴지통으로 이동합니다.
  2. VS 코드 삭제 파일은 휴지통에 있습니다.
  3. 따라서 삭제 된 파일을 마우스 오른쪽 버튼으로 클릭하고 선택-> 복원 옵션을 선택하면 삭제 된 파일이 VS 코드에서 자동으로 복원됩니다.

2
실제로 작동합니다! 휴지통에서 모든 파일을 찾았습니다. 감사합니다 남자
푸 아드 Boukredine

10

OP가 휴지통이라고 말하는 것을 알고 있습니다. 내가하는 일은 특히 단일 파일 인 경우 파일을 다시 만드는 것입니다. 파일에있을 때 CMD + Z (Mac에 있음)를 누르면 파일을 다시 가져옵니다.

  1. 삭제 된 동일한 디렉토리에 파일을 다시 작성하십시오.
  2. 새로 생성 된 파일 내부의 CMD + Z.


3

실수로 VS Code에서 소스 제어의 변경 사항을 삭제했습니다.이 파일을 다시 열고 Ctrl-Z를 몇 번 누르면 VS Code가 변경 사항을 저장하게되어 기쁩니다.


2

휴지통에서 삭제 한 파일을 찾아보세요. 그것을 마우스 오른쪽 버튼으로 클릭하고 다른 삭제 된 파일을 정상적으로 복원하십시오. VS 코드도 시스템의 일반 쓰레기를 사용하기 때문에 평소와 비슷합니다.


1

Vs Studio 코드를 통해 저장소를 Github에 푸시하는 동안 전체 폴더를 삭제 했으며 휴지통에서도 사용할 수 없었습니다 . 이 파일을 복구하는 방법은 다음과 같습니다. Windows의 경우 .

삭제 된 파일이 있던 드라이브의 이전 버전복원하는 방법입니다.

G : 드라이브에서 파일을 삭제했습니다. 아래 이미지는 설명이 필요하지 않습니다.

드라이브의 속성 메뉴 열기

여기에 이미지 설명 입력

속성에서 이전 버전 탭으로 이동하면 백업 사용 날짜와 함께 해당 드라이브의 이전 버전을 찾을 수 있으며 해당 드라이브의 이전 버전을 가져 오려면 복원을 클릭합니다.

여기에 이미지 설명 입력

참고 : 복원 지점 후 드라이브에서 조작 할 수 없습니다.


안녕하세요 저도 같은 문제에 직면하지만 내 경우에는 이전 버전이없는거야
사드 아바

파일 기록이 꺼져 있으면 작동하지 않으며 복구 할 수 없습니다.
Saad Abbasi

@SaadAbbasi 나는 2 일 동안 시도했지만 이전 버전을 복원이 내가 찾은 유일한 솔루션입니다
NIRANJAN S PATTANSHETTI에게

안타깝게도 파일 기록이 활성화되지 않아 복구 할 수 없었습니다. 나는 모든 것을 다시 할 것이다. :(
Saad Abbasi

1
@SaadAbbasi 확실하지는 않지만 여기에 링크 에 도움이 될 몇 가지 리소스가 있습니다 . [link] (wintips.org/fix-restore-previous-versions-not-working-in-windows-10/) 작동 할 수 있습니다. )
NIRANJAN S PATTANSHETTI

1

파일을 방금 삭제했다면 VSCode 1.52 (2020 년 12 월) 가 다음을 지원합니다.

탐색기에서 파일 작업 실행 취소

Explorer는 이제 삭제, 이름 변경, 복사, 이동, 새 파일 및 새 폴더와 같은 모든 파일 작업에 대해 실행 취소 및 다시 실행을 지원합니다 .

포커스가 탐색기에 있는지 확인하고 실행 취소 또는 다시 실행 명령을 실행하면 마지막 파일 작업이 각각 실행 취소되거나 다시 실행됩니다.
편집기와 탐색기에 대해 별도의 실행 취소 스택이 있으며 포커스에 따라 실행 취소 할 스택을 선택합니다.

탐색기 실행 취소-https://media.githubusercontent.com/media/microsoft/vscode-docs/vnext/release-notes/images/1_52/explorer-undo.gif


0

로컬 디렉터리에 git이 초기화되었고 삭제를 포함하는 변경 사항을 커밋하지 않은 경우 git checkout -f를 사용 하여 로컬 변경 사항을 삭제할 수 있습니다 .


0
  1. 컴퓨터의 휴지통으로 이동합니다 .
  2. 삭제 된 특정 파일 을 검색합니다 .
  3. 해당 파일을 마우스 오른쪽 버튼으로 클릭하십시오 . 드롭 다운 목록 에서 복원으로 이동 합니다 .

짜잔! 파일이 복원되고 폴더로 돌아갑니다. 행복한 코딩!


2
이미 존재하는 답변과 본질적으로 유사한 답변으로 4 년 된 질문에 답변 한 이유는 무엇입니까? 이전 질문에 대한 답변을 추가하려면 관련성 있고 새로운 것을 추가해야합니다. 당신의 대답은 정말 .. 상단에 두 개의 답변하지 않습니다 아무것도 추가하지 않습니다
글렌 매킨토시에게

0

VS 코드 1.51.0으로 Ubuntu 18.04에서 실행

VS Code에서 삭제 된 파일은 다음 위치에 있습니다.

~ / .local / share / Trash / files

삭제 된 파일을 검색하려면 :

find ~/.local/share/Trash/files -name your_file_name 

내 케이스가 도움이 되었기를 바랍니다!

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.